No Pictures Needed... I installed this on my protege5 but im sure this goes for all 3rd generation protege's including speed and mp3
Wiring Instruction:
TurboXS Knocklite and stock knock sensor wiring
TurboXS black wire = ground to chassis
TurboXS red wire = ignition controlled positive wire
TurboXS orange wire = PIN 48 on ECU (lavender/grey wire)
TurboXS white wire = PIN 59 on ECU (red wire)
Very simple install... should take less than 30min
the only thing i had to experiment with is finding the stock knock sensor signal wire... could of been either pin 57 or pin 59 which are taped together near the ecu... at first i tried pin 57 since it was the wire connecting to the stock knock sensor red wire and pin 59 was connected to the stock knock sensors black wire... ran it for a week and the knock lite wouldn't come on except when it was time to shift (green light)... just switched it last night to pin 59 and I got some knock (amber light) around 5500rpm... so that confirms that the stock knock signal is comming from pin 59 of the ecu...
Configuring the knocklite can be done by following the included instructions that are packaged with the TurboXS knocklite.
